subpar

From Wiktionary, the free dictionary

See also: sub-par

English

Etymology

From sub- + par.

Pronunciation

Adjective

subpar (not comparable)

  1. Of less than a traditional or accepted standard.
    Synonyms: below par, under par
    Coordinate terms: up to par, above par
    Bob's grasp of English was subpar.
  2. (golf) Synonym of below par
  3. (finance) Trading a price below face value.
